Exploring the Benefits of Investing in Commodities

Investing in commodities is a great way to diversify your portfolio and potentially increase your returns. Commodities are physical goods such as oil, gold, and wheat, which are traded on the open market. They are often seen as a hedge against inflation and can provide a steady stream of income.
